Macnica Networks announces distribution agreement with N3N, Inc.

Macnica Networks Corp. (Headquarters: 1-5-5 Shin-Yokohama, Kouhoku-ku, Yokohama, Japan President: Jun Ikeda), a leading supplier of network equipment and security solutions, is pleased to announce a distribution agreement with N3N Inc (Headquarters: 6F, 10, Gukhoe-daero 76-Gil Yeoungdeungpo-gu, Seoul, Korea; CEO: Nam Young Sam). N3N provides a visualization software platform that enables large organizations to actualize their workflows, processes and very own Internet of Things (IoT).

Many companies are launching efforts to innovate their existing business model by digitizing their businesses in order to improve and increase its business productivity and efficiency (ie: reduce operational cost, save time, improve collaboration and increase profits). However, there are hindrances to digitizing their businesses to include “siloed” organizations, data governance policies and the cost of digitization which requires expensive custom-built solutions. Macnica Networks, utilizing N3N’s WIZEYE visualization platform, has launched a digital consulting service to support companies in their shift towards digital transformation.
WIZEYE visualization platform provides an easy way to manage, isolate and solve operational problems all from a single visual display. It gives you the capability to locate and resolve problems in Real-Time.

WIZEYE integrates and hierarchically organizes a company’s various types of data - both structured and unstructured - to enable real-time visualization and allow easy analysis via a single platform. Utilizing WIZEYE, users themselves can edit real-time data and display configurations easily and inexpensively. In addition, WIZEYE enables single-view sharing of IoT data, other types of data and displays alarms for a range of risk factors. This means everyone involved in dealing with a problem, from management to the responsible employees, sees the same information on the same screen - thus enabling smooth problem resolution.
WIZEYE has already been deployed all over the world in system infrastructures such as Smart Cities, Smart Operations and other IoT environments. It has helped maximize corporate value in the form of increased profits and streamlined operations as more and more digital businesses utilize IoT data.

Use case examples of WIZEYE visualization platform developed by N3N

1Smart Cities

By integrating and visualizing various types of information such as sensor data, maps and video, the entire infrastructures of vast urban areas can be managed in real-time. Camera-based surveillance systems can be constructed by using camera images, while platforms based on IoT and public data can be built by integrating and visualizing camera images, maps and infrastructure data. By integrating and managing various types of data, a city can aggregate all of its data and advance the mechanism of its operation-facilitating problem-solving and reducing personnel costs.

Data sharing enabled by visualization platforms will contribute to add value through the creation of new services such as easing traffic congestion, improving safety, managing disasters, and beyond.

2Smart Operations

Across a range of industries, WIZEYE is used by front-line operators who have benefited from the rapid sharing of events and resolution of problems enabled by the digitization of many operations including the management of data, operators, production facilities and production quality. By integrating data concerning, data centers, factories, retail stores and surveillance facilities from all over the world onto a single screen, businesses can create operational systems that are optimized and tailored to their own industry - thereby improving efficiency

N3N Company Profile

N3N, Inc. makes software that helps large organizations visualize their operations. We provide the world’s number one Internet of Things visualization platform, deployed globally with Fortune 500 and Global 2000 companies, across several verticals. Our solution is used in the public sector (Smart Cities), and in the manufacturing, supply chain, hospitality, retail, telecom and other verticals, where our customers re-shape their operations based on insights gained from visualizing and analyzing their workflows, processes and their very own Internet of Things. AT&T is a partner, and Cisco Systems is an investor and partner.
